Types of Body Kits for Tesla Model X
Body kits come in various forms, catering to different styles, functionalities, and performance needs. Here are some popular options available for the Tesla Model X:
1. Full Body Kits
Full body kits are designed to transform the entire exterior of the vehicle. They typically include front and rear bumpers, side skirts, and sometimes even fenders. Brands like CMST Tuning and RPM Tesla offer comprehensive kits that enhance both aesthetics and aerodynamics.
2. Carbon Fiber Kits
Carbon fiber kits are popular among enthusiasts due to their lightweight properties and sporty appearance. These kits, offered by companies like DarwinPRO and CMST, are engineered to improve performance by reducing weight while enhancing the vehicle’s look.
3. Customizable Kits
For those who want a unique design, customizable body kits allow you to select specific components based on personal preference. Maxton Design and Forza Performance Group provide options that let owners mix and match parts according to their style.
4. Limited Edition Kits
Limited edition kits, like the T Largo edition, offer exclusive designs and features that set your Model X apart from the rest. These kits are often produced in smaller quantities, making them a unique choice for collectors and enthusiasts.
Benefits of Installing a Body Kit
Upgrading your Tesla Model X with a body kit provides several advantages, beyond just aesthetics:
Enhanced Aerodynamics
Body kits are designed to improve airflow around the vehicle, reducing drag and increasing efficiency. This is particularly crucial for electric vehicles like the Model X, where aerodynamics significantly affect range.
Weight Reduction
Many modern body kits utilize lightweight materials like carbon fiber, helping to reduce the overall weight of the vehicle. This weight reduction can lead to better acceleration and improved handling.
Improved Aesthetics
Body kits add a sporty, aggressive look to your Model X, making it stand out on the road. Whether you prefer a sleek design or a more rugged appearance, there are options available to suit every style.
Increased Resale Value
Investing in high-quality body kits can enhance the resale value of your vehicle. An upgraded exterior often attracts buyers looking for a unique and well-maintained vehicle.
Customization Options
With a wide variety of designs and components available, body kits allow you to personalize your Model X according to your taste. This level of customization is appealing to many Tesla owners who want their vehicle to reflect their personality.

FAQ
What is a body kit?
A body kit is a collection of exterior modifications designed to enhance the appearance and performance of a vehicle. It can include components like bumpers, side skirts, and spoilers.
Why should I consider a body kit for my Tesla Model X?
Body kits improve the aerodynamics, reduce weight, and enhance the overall look of your vehicle, making it stand out while providing performance benefits.
What materials are commonly used in body kits?
Most body kits are made from materials like carbon fiber, fiberglass, or ABS plastic, each offering different benefits in terms of weight, durability, and cost.
How do I choose the right body kit for my Model X?
Consider your personal style, desired performance enhancements, and budget. Research various brands and products to find a kit that meets your needs.
Can I install a body kit myself?
While some body kits come with installation instructions that allow for DIY installation, it’s often recommended to have a professional install them to ensure proper fit and finish.
What are the performance benefits of a body kit?
Body kits can improve aerodynamics, which may lead to better fuel efficiency and handling, and some kits may also reduce weight, enhancing acceleration and cornering.
Will a body kit void my warranty?
This can depend on the manufacturer and the specific modifications made. Always check with your vehicle’s manufacturer or dealership regarding warranty implications.
How do I maintain my body kit?
Regular washing and appropriate wax or sealant can help maintain the appearance and longevity of the body kit. Avoid using harsh chemicals that can damage the finish.
Are body kits legal?
Most body kits are street-legal, but it’s important to check local regulations regarding vehicle modifications, as some may have restrictions on certain designs or components.
